The Role of Bonuses and Promotions

A key component of the modern gaming landscape is the prevalence of bonuses and promotions. These incentives, ranging from welcome bonuses for new players to ongoing loyalty rewards, serve as a powerful marketing tool for attracting and retaining customers. While bonuses can undoubtedly enhance the gaming experience, it's crucial to understand the associated terms and conditions. Wagering requirements, maximum bet limits, and game restrictions are common stipulations that players should carefully review before accepting a bonus offer. Failing to do so can lead to frustration and difficulty withdrawing winnings. Smart players view bonuses as an added benefit, not a guaranteed path to profit.

Bonus Type Description Typical Wagering Requirement
Welcome Bonus Offered to new players upon registration and first deposit. 30x – 50x the bonus amount
Deposit Bonus A percentage match on a player's deposit. 35x – 60x the bonus amount
Free Spins Allows players to spin a slot game without wagering real money. 20x – 40x the winnings from the spins
Loyalty Program Rewards players based on their level of activity and spending. Varies depending on the program

Effective bonus strategies involve carefully selecting offers that align with your preferred games and wagering style. Understanding the intricacies of wagering requirements can maximize your chances of converting a bonus into real cash winnings. It’s about informed participation, not chasing unrealistic expectations.

The Importance of Responsible Gaming

The ease of access to online gaming platforms underscores the critical importance of responsible gaming practices. While these platforms offer entertainment and potential financial rewards, they also carry inherent risks, particularly for individuals susceptible to problem gambling. Establishing clear boundaries, setting deposit limits, and avoiding chasing losses are essential strategies for maintaining control and preventing gambling from becoming a destructive force. Many platforms now incorporate t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its, such as self-exclusion options and access to support organizations.

Recognizing the signs of problem gambling – spending more time and money than intended, neglecting personal responsibilities,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ame – is crucial. Seeking help from friends, family, or a professional counselor can provide valuable support and guidance. The online gaming industry has a responsibility to promote responsible gambling, and many operators are actively investing in initiatives to raise awareness and protect vulnerable individuals. A healthy relationship with gaming is one based on informed choices and mindful moderation.

  • Set a budget and stick to it.
  • Only gamble with money you can afford to lose.
  • Avoid chasing losses.
  • Take frequent breaks.
  • Don't gamble when you're feeling stressed or emotional.
  • Utilize self-exclusion tools if needed.
  • Seek help if you think you may have a problem.

Proactive self-regulation and utilizing the available resources are paramount for a positive and sustainable gaming experience. A commitment to responsible habits ensures that gaming remains a source of enjoyment, not a source of hardship.

Navigating the Security Landscape

Security is paramount within the online gambling industry. Players entrust platforms with sensitive personal and financial information, making them attractive targets for cybercriminals. Reputable platforms employ a variety of security measures to protect against fraud, data breaches, and other malicious activities. These measures include advanced encryption technologies, secure payment gateways, and robust firewall systems. Regular security audits and compliance with industry standards are essential components of a strong security posture.

Players also have a role to play in safeguarding their own accounts. Choosing strong, unique passwords, enabling two-factor authentication, and being wary of phishing scams are simple yet effective steps that can significantly reduce the risk of unauthorized access. Avoiding public Wi-Fi networks when making transactions and regularly reviewing account activity for suspicious behavior are also prudent practices. A layered approach to security, combining platform-level protections with individual user vigilance, is the most effective strategy.

Understanding Licensing and Regulation

The legitimacy of an online gaming platform is heavily reliant on its licensing and regulatory status. Licensing ensures that the platform operates in compliance with strict rules and regulations designed to protect players and ensure fair gaming practices. Reputable licensing jurisdictions, such as Malta, Gibraltar, and the United Kingdom, have stringent requirements for operators, including financial stability, security protocols, and responsible gaming measures. Players should always verify that a platform holds a valid license from a respected regulatory body before depositing funds or engaging in real-money gaming. The presence of a license provides a degree of assurance that the platform is operating legally and ethically.

  1. Check for a valid license from a reputable jurisdiction.
  2. Review the platform's terms and conditions.
  3. Research the platform's security measures.
  4. Read player reviews and feedback.
  5. Verify the fairness of the games through independent testing.
  6. Understand the platform's dispute resolution process.
  7. Ensure the platform supports responsible gaming practices.

Diligent research and verification are essential steps in mitigating risk and selecting a trustworthy gaming platform. Understanding the regulatory landscape empowers players to make informed decisions and protect their interests.
